Đề tài phân tích và thiết kế hệ thống quản lý tuyển sinh đại học

33 6 0
Đề tài phân tích và thiết kế hệ thống quản lý tuyển sinh đại học

Đang tải... (xem toàn văn)

Tài liệu hạn chế xem trước, để xem đầy đủ mời bạn chọn Tải xuống

Thông tin tài liệu

LỜI NĨI ĐẦU Ngày nay, cơng nghệ thơng tin ngày phát triển không ngừng ngày tỏ rõ tầm quan trọng việc đánh giá xã hội phát triển – xã hội mà người giải phóng khỏi cơng cụ thơ sơ tay sang làm máy móc nhằm giải công việc nhanh tiết kiệm thời gian đẹp Vì lẽ đó, cơng nghệ tin học ngày đưa vào lĩnh vực, nghành nghề, tiến tới tự động hố tồn hoạt động Và để phục vụ cho công việc, nghành giáo dục đào tạo nghành thiết phải tin học hoá lĩnh vực quản lý, đào tạo người… nhằm nâng cao hiệu việc tiếp cận nhanh chóng với công nghệ quản lý công tác đào tạo nhanh chóng, hiệu Sau học xong mơn học Phân tích thiết kế hệ thống thơng tin, nhận thức rõ tầm quan trọng bước đầu lập trình chương trình nào, chúng em xin vận dụng kiến thức học để thiết kế chương trình quản lý tuyển sinh đại học với đề tài: "Phân tích thiết kế hệ thống quản lý tuyển sinh đại học".Vì thời gian có hạn, chắn tập cịn có nhiều thiếu xót Chúng em mong giúp đỡ góp ý để chương trình hồn thiện, cho chúng em tích luỹ kinh nghiệm để phục vụ sau Chúng em xin chân thành cảm ơn cô LUAN VAN CHAT LUONG download : add luanvanchat@agmail.com CHƢƠNG I: MỘT VÀI KHÁI NIỆM VỀ CSDL Cơ sở liệu(CSDL): Là tập hợp liệu có mối quan hệ độc lập với nhau, lưu trữ máy theo quy luật định CSDL thành lập từ tập tin sở liệu để dễ dàng khai thác xử lý Tác động thay đổi liệu gọi Hệ quản trị sở liệu Cơ sở liệu quan hệ: Gọi R = [A1…An] tập hợp hữu hạn thuộc tính, thuộc tính Ai vơi i = n có miền giá trị tương ứng dom(Ai) Quan hệ tập thuộc tính R = [Ai…An] tập tích Đề Các r  dom(ai)x…x dom (An) Miền (domain): Là tệp giá trị Mỗi hàng quan hệ gọi (tuples) Các cột quan hệ gọi thuộc tính Khố (key): khố quan hệ r tập thuộc tính R=[ A1…An] tập K  R cho hai khác t1 ,t2  r thoả t1(K)t2(K), tập thực K’ Knào khơng có tính chất đố Tập K siêu khoá (superkey) quan hệ r K khoá quan hệ r 4.Thực thể: chủ điểm, nhiệm vụ, đối tượng hay kiện đáng quan tâm tổ chức mà ghi lại liêụ chúng Một thực thể tương đương với dòng bảng Kiểu thực thể nhóm tự nhiên số thực thể lại, mô tả cho loại thông tin thân thông tin Kiểu thực thể tương đương với bảng logic Thuộc tính đặc trưng thực thể, biểu thị trường cột bảng Biểu đồ thực thể liên kết (Entity Relationship Diagram) mơ hình thơng tin liệu hệ thống, làm nhiệm vụ mô tả quan hệ thực thể xác định thuộc tính chúng * Mối quan hệ thực thể liên kết: Có quan hệ chính: Xét mơ hình IE: a) Quan hệ 1-1: A Chú thích [Qst1]: B Mỗi đại diện cho lớp thực thể A tương ứng với đại diện cho lớp thực thể B ngược lại b) Quan hệ 1- nhiều: LUAN VAN CHAT LUONG download : add luanvanchat@agmail.com A < B Mỗi đại diện lớp thực thể A tương ứng với nhiều đại diện lớp thực thể B, ngược lại đại diện lớp thực thể B tương ứng với đại diện lớp thực thể A c) Quan hệ nhiều- nhiều: A > < B Mỗi đại diện lớp thực thể A tương ứng với nhiều đại diện lớp thực thể B ngược lại 5.Mơ hình quan hệ: tập tích đề miền liệu r (A1,A2,A3…An) r(A)= (A1 A2 A3 …An) * Chuẩn hoá: thủ tục hình thức hố qua thuộc tính liệu gom nhóm thành bảng bảng gom nhóm thành sở liệu nhằm mục tiêu: + Loại bỏ thông tin trùng lặp, tránh dư thừa liệu bảng + Điều chỉnh thay đổi tương lai cấu trúc bảng + Giảm thiểu mức ảnh hưởng thay đổi cấu trúc sở liệu ứng dụng người dùng truy xuất liệu Q trình chuẩn hố dựa phụ thuộc hàm, mơ hình chuẩn hố đầy đủ, lý tưởng mơ hình mà thuộc tính bảng thực thể có phụ thuộc hàm trực tiếp vào thuộc tính khố bảng * Phụ thuộc hàm: nghĩa với giá trị khố thời điểm xét có giá trị cho thuộc tính khác bảng Ta định nghĩa phụ thuộc hàm cách thức sau: Cho R(U) lược đồ quan hệ với U(A1…An) tập thuộc tính, X Y tập U Nói X  Y (đọc X xác định hàm Y Y phụ thuộc hàm vào X) r quan hệ xác định R(U) cho hai t1 t2 r mà: t1 [X]= t2 [X] t1[Y] =t2[Y] Quă trình chuẩn hố bao gồm dạng chuẩn hố sau: NF (first Normal Forms): Quan hệ chứa thuộc tính đơn (khơng chia nhỏ được) NF(Second Normal Forms): nếu:+ QH phải 1NF LUAN VAN CHAT LUONG download : add luanvanchat@agmail.com + Các thuộc tính khơng khố phụ thuộc đầy đủ vào khố 3NF: + QH phải NF + Mọi thuộc tính khơng khố khơng phụ thuộc bắc cầu vào khố  Tìm tập phụ thuộc hàm tối thiểu(tách không mát thông tin) CHƢƠNGII KHẢO SÁT HIỆN TRẠNG I Giới thiệu đề tài quản lý công tác tuyển sinh Công tác tuyển sinh vấn đề mang tính thực tế sâu sắc Xuất phát từ yêu cầu thực tế công tác tuyển sinh năm qua ta thấy: có nhiều thành phần thơng tin cần quản lý Thực có khối lượng cơng việt lớn cần đến trợ giúp máy tính Các chương trình sử dụng hỗ trợ phần nhữnh khó khăn việc tuyển sinh nói chung chưa thoả mãn nhu cầu cần thiết cơng tác tuyển sinh ngày có nhiều vấn đề phức tạp nảy sinh Vì đồ án chúng em muốn đưa cách tiếp cận giải vấn đề với mục tiêu tự động hố cơng việc tính tốn, xử lí tài liệu, cách thức truy xuất thông tin giảm thiểu công tác xử lý thủ công Giảm thiểu nhiệm vụ người hệ thống tạo nên thống chức thành hệ thống thống có tổ chức chặt chẽ II Nhận xét ƣu khuyết điểm hệ thống cũ chuyển sang hệ thống Qua trình khảo sát, tìm hiểu cơng tác tuyển sinh vào trường đại học chúng em thấy hệ thống lúc nhiều vấn đề yếu kém, hệ thống tuyển sinh đại học đơn xếp liệu máy tính , in giấy báo thi cho thí sinh.Ở hệ thống cịn q nhiều khâu mà phải tính thủ cơng dễ dẫn đến nhầm lẫn điểm số thí sinh Vấn đề tìm kiếm thơng tin hệ thống có nhiều khó khăn nhiều thời gian Với yếu ban tuyển sinh định cải tiến hệ thống tuyển sinh nhằm rút ngắn thời gian xử lý tránh cho thí sinh phải đợi kết thi thời gian dài LUAN VAN CHAT LUONG download : add luanvanchat@agmail.com Đảm bảo cho xử lý liệu nhanh chóng ,cơng tác xử lý thơng tin diễn nhanh chóng Cho phép trao đổi thơng tin nhanh chóng phận hệ thống Hệ thống cho phép tra cứu nhanh chóng thơng tin, điểm số in danh sách, giấy báo thi, báo điểm III.Nhiệm vụ hệ thống Qua vấn đề mang nhiều tính khái qt ta có tể xác định nhiệm vụ hệ thống quản lý công tác tuyển sinh vào trường đại học Mục tiêu hệ thống phát huy điểm tích cực hệ thống có, khắc phục vấn đề cịn thiếu xót để tạo nên hệ thống hoàn thiện đáp ứng nhu cầu cấp thiết thực tế Các máy tính hệ thống có nhiệm vụ cập nhật hồ sơ tuyển sinh cá thí sinh phải phân loại theo khu vực tuyển sinh, đối tượng dự tuyển mức ưu tiên cho thí sinh Tồn thơng tin thí sinh đăng kí dự thi lưu sở liệu máy chủ kiểm tra thông tin dự thi hợp lệ hệ thống tuyển sinh lên danh sách phòng thi , số báo danh địa điểm dự thi đồng thời in giấy báo thi (tài liệu xuất ) gửi cho thí sinh đăng kí dự thi Khi thí sinh nộp thi ban tuyển sinh rọc phách chuyển cho cán chấm thi Cịn thơng tin số báo danh ,số phách lưu lại để thuận lợi cho việc khớp điểm sau Khi cán chấm thi trả cho ban tuyển sinh hệ thơng thực nhiệm vụ lên điểm theo phách (ghép phách ) môn thi Dựa vào thông tin số báo danh, số phách để thực viẹc ghép phách lên kết Sau tính tốn hệ thống đưa thông báo kết tuyển sinh thí sinh dạng sau : SBD Họ tên Hộ Môn Môn Môn 3452 1873 … Nguyễn văn A Bùi thị X … KV1 KV2 … … 10 … … Tổng điểm 25 27 … Sau có tồn điểm thi thí sinh, dựa vào tiêu xét tuyển quy chế tuyển sinh hệ thống xác định điểm xét tuyển trường Đến hệ thống in giấy báo điểm cho thí sinh Sau gửi giấy báo điểm cho thí sinh dự thi Nếu thí sinh có đơn phúc tra thi hệ thống dựa vào số báo danh, mơn thi để tìm lại thi để giải đáp thắc thí sinh sửa đổi điểm số(trường hợp LUAN VAN CHAT LUONG download : add luanvanchat@agmail.com giáo viên chấm thi nhầm lẫn) dựa theo kết phúc tra đồng thời in kết gửu đến cho thí sinh Vậy, hệ thống đảm bảo cho cơng tác tìm kiếm kết thuận lợi, cụ thể tiêu chí như: tìm kiếm theo số báo danh, tên, trường CHƢƠNG III PHÂN TÍCH HỆ THỐNG Trong q trình xây dựng hệ quản trị máy tính, phân tích cơng việc thiếu Không thể đưa tin học hố vào cơng tác quản lý mà khơng qua q trình phân tích Hiệu mang lại phụ thuộc vào độ nơng sâu q trình phân tích ban đầu Để hệ thống mang tích thực tế đáp ứng nhu cầu người dùng dựa vào trình khảo sát trạng xác lập dự án chúng em xin đưa luồng thông tin đáp ứng dược nhu cầu hệ thống:  Dữ liệu: hệ thống tuyển sinh trọng vào công tác xử lý, hồ sơ tuyển sinh, xác định rõ đối tượng ưu tiên, dựa vào điểm số thi thí sinh  Luồng thơng tin vào: thơng tin nhận từ lãnh đạo,ban tuyển sinh, quy chế tuyển sinh Bộ Giáo dục Đào tạo  Luồng thông tin loại văn bản, báo cáo: Giấy báo thi, giấy báo điểm, thơng báo phịng thi, số báo danh, địa điểm thi, kết phúc tra, giấy dán phòng thi, sơ đồ phòng thi( cần), kết thi I.Phân tích hệ thống xử lý: 1.Biểu đồ phân rã chức năng: Chứng hệ thống mang tên “quản lý tuyển sinh ĐH” Trong biểu đồ phân rã chức chức chung phân rã thành chức con: - Xử lý học sinh - Làm số báo danh, phòng thi - Xử lý thi - Khớp điểm - Lên điểm theo phách - Tìm kiếm thống kê - Xử lý phúc tra - In ấn Biểu đồ phân rã chức năng: LUAN VAN CHAT LUONG download : add luanvanchat@agmail.com LUAN VAN CHAT LUONG download : add luanvanchat@agmail.com Quản lý công tác tuyển sinh đại học Xử lý hồ Sơ - Nhận hồ sơ - Kiểm tra số học sinh Làm SBD, phòng thi Xử lý thi Khớp điểm Lên điểm theo phách Tìm kiếm, thống kê Xử lý phúc tra In ấn - Đánh SBD - Kiểm tra SBD - Ghi nhận SBD #Ghi vào tệp SBD/Thísinh /phịng thi - Làm phách - Nhập số phách - Chuyển tới cán chấm thi # Ghi vào tệp Số phách/ Môn thi/SBD - Nhập điểm theo phách - Ghi nhận điểm - Kiểm tra thông tin phách # Ghi vào tệp Môn/Số phách/SBD - Ghép phách - Lên điểm+SBD - Đối chiếu thông tin - Xử lý ưu tiên - Xử lý điểm chuẩn - Tìm theo SBD - Tìm theo tên - Thống kê thí sinh đạt - Thống kê theo chế độ ưu tiên - Nhận yêu cầu - Xử lý phúc tra - Ghi nhận phúc tra - Trả lời phúc tra - In giấy báo thi - In kết thi - Kết tuyển sinh LUAN VAN CHAT LUONG download : add luanvanchat@agmail.com Tuy nhiên, biểu đồ thể đ-ợc phân cấp chức dạng tĩnh Để hình dung rõ hệ thống, ta cần xem xét luồng thông tin từ môi tr-ờng ngoài, kết mà hệ thống trả cho ng-ời sử dụng luồng thông tin truyền tiến trình Yêu cầu đ-ợc thể biểu đồ luồng liệu hệ thống 2.Biểu ®å lng d÷ liƯu BiĨu ®å lng d÷ liƯu thĨ hệ thống dạng động Nó thể trao đổi thông tin hệ thống với môi tr-òng bên luồng trao đổi thông tin nội hệ thống Biểu đồ luồng liệu bao gồm tác nhân bên bên hệ thống, tiến trình xử lý thông tin, luồng thông tin vào/ra tiến trình.Mối liên quan biểu đò phân cấp chức biểu đồ luồng liệu chức biểu đồ phân cấp chức t-ơng ứng với tiến trình biều đồ luồng liệu; mức biểu đồ phân cấp chức đ-ợc mô tả biểu đồ luồng liệu t-ơng ứng Ta tiến hành xây dựng biẻu đồ luồng liệu cho hệ thống dựa vào biểu đồ phân cấp chức đà xây dựng nh- sau: 2.1 Biểu đồ luồng liệu møc khung c¶nh: Møc khung c¶nh t-ong øng víi møc biểu đồ phân cấp chức Ta coi hộp đen, thông tin từ môi trường ngoi vo hệ thống thông tin đầu vào; thông tin từ hệ thống đ-a bên thông tin đầu ra; nhiệm vụ hệ thống phải xử lý, biến đổi thông tin đầu vào thành kết đầu LUAN VAN CHAT LUONG download : add luanvanchat@agmail.com Hå s¬ Quy chế ts Ban tuyển sinh Yêu cầu Bài thi Báo cáo kq Đơn phúc tra Thí sinh Quản lý tuyển sinh Giấy báo thi Kết phúc tra Tr-ờng §H Điểm thi ts Bài thi Yêu cầu + tiêu Cán chấm thi Các tác nhân ngồi: -Thí sinh: người dự thi -Ban tuyển sinh: Ban lãnh đạo công tác tuyển sinh đưa quy chế xét tuyển -Trường ĐH: Đưa tiêu tuyển sinh 2.2 Biểu đồ liệu mức đỉnh: Mức đỉnh ứng với mức biểu đồ phân rã chức Hệ thống quản lý tuyển sinh đại học chia thành chức Trong biểu đồ thong tin vào xác lập dựa yêu cầu kết trả chức 10 LUAN VAN CHAT LUONG download : add luanvanchat@agmail.com Điểm Điểm ưu tiên >

Ngày đăng: 10/10/2022, 15:56

Hình ảnh liên quan

5.Bảng ghộp phỏch: kết xuất từ 2 bảng 3 và 4 - Đề tài phân tích và thiết kế hệ thống quản lý tuyển sinh đại học

5..

Bảng ghộp phỏch: kết xuất từ 2 bảng 3 và 4 Xem tại trang 25 của tài liệu.
4.Bảng ghi phần lờn điểm theo phỏch: - Đề tài phân tích và thiết kế hệ thống quản lý tuyển sinh đại học

4..

Bảng ghi phần lờn điểm theo phỏch: Xem tại trang 25 của tài liệu.

Tài liệu cùng người dùng

  • Đang cập nhật ...

Tài liệu liên quan